🤖 AI-Assisted Contributions
If any part of this PR was generated or assisted by AI tools (Copilot, Claude, ChatGPT, etc.), all items below are mandatory. You are fully responsible for every line you submit. "The AI wrote it" is not an excuse, and AI-generated PRs that clearly haven't been reviewed are the #1 reason PRs get closed.
- I have read and understand every line of this PR and can explain any part of it during review
- I personally ran the code and verified it works (not just trusted the AI's output)
- PR is scoped to a single logical change, not a dump of everything the AI suggested
- Tests validate actual behavior, not just coverage (AI-generated tests often assert nothing meaningful)
- No dead code, placeholder comments,
TODOs, or unused scaffolding left behind by AI - I did not submit refactors, style changes, or "improvements" the AI suggested beyond the scope of the issue
